The Council of Ministers approves the draft resolution defining the areas of the Ta’izz International Airport campus

The Council approved the draft resolution submitted by the Minister of Transport, Abdulwahab Al-Durra, on the amendment of Cabinet Decision No. (96) for the year 2008, on the determination of the areas of the Ta ‘izz International Airport campus, in addition to the future development plan of the Ta’ izz Airport for the next 50 years, which comes within the framework of the rehabilitation, development and operation of the airport, from its vital function serving a large population density of 10 million people.

The Council of Ministers has formed a committee headed by the Deputy Prime Minister for National Vision Affairs and members of all ministries and relevant bodies, as well as the Secretary-General of the Council of Ministers and the Governor of Ta ‘izz, to complete the necessary procedures for the implementation of the resolution with the headquarters amendment, ensure its implementation and develop the executive mechanism of the airport’s development plan.

The decision is made to determine the airport campus in a scientific manner, to ensure that the real-time and future need for land for 50 years is strictly met, to ensure that the requirements of aviation security and safety are met and to preserve the land and property of the Muslim State of the General Authority for Civil Aviation and Meteorology for use for the operation of Ta ‘izz International Airport and the future expansion of the airport outlined in the future plan.

The Council of Ministers confirmed that the airport campus schemes, which are annexed to the draft amendment, are an integral part of this resolution.
